Comprehensive ocular and systemic pharmacokinetics of dexamethasone after subconjunctival and intravenous injections in rabbits
European Journal of Pharmaceutics and Biopharmaceutics ( IF 4.9 ) Pub Date : 2024-03-12 , DOI: 10.1016/j.ejpb.2024.114260
Annika Valtari , Susanna Posio , Elisa Toropainen , Anusha Balla , Jooseppi Puranen , Amir Sadeghi , Marika Ruponen , Veli-Pekka Ranta , Kati-Sisko Vellonen , Arto Urtti , Eva M. del Amo

Even though subconjunctival injections are used in clinics, their quantitative pharmacokinetics has not been studied systematically. For this purpose, we evaluated the ocular and plasma pharmacokinetics of subconjunctival dexamethasone in rabbits. Intravenous injection was also given to enable a better understanding of the systemic pharmacokinetics. Dexamethasone concentrations in plasma (after subconjunctival and intravenous injections) and four ocular tissues (iris-ciliary body, aqueous humour, neural retina and vitreous) were analysed using LC-MS/MS.
